Monosodium Phosphate (MSP) CAS No.7558-80-7

Monosodium Phosphate (MSP) CAS No. 7558-80-7, is an inorganic compound commonly available as a white crystalline powder. It is highly soluble in water and widely used in the food, pharmaceutical, and industrial sectors due to its buffering, sequestrant, and emulsifying properties.

Chemical Formula: NaH2PO4
Molecular weight: 119.98
Standard executed: GB 25564-2010/FCC
Properties: White powder or granular in appearance. Easily soluble in water, but insoluble in organic solvents.

Key Applications of Monosodium Phosphate (MSP) CAS No.7558-80-7

1. Food Industry

In the food industry, MSP is widely applied as a food additive (E339a). It serves as a pH regulator, emulsifier, and nutritional supplement. MSP is often used in dairy products, beverages, baked goods, and processed meats to stabilize quality and extend shelf life.

2. Pharmaceutical Applications

In the pharmaceutical field, Monosodium Phosphate is used as a buffering agent in formulations and laboratory research. It also serves as a component in laxatives and saline solutions, contributing to medical and healthcare applications.

3. Water Treatment

MSP is applied in water treatment systems as a scale inhibitor and corrosion control agent. It helps maintain water quality by preventing scale formation and metal corrosion in pipelines and boilers.

4. Industrial Uses

Beyond food and pharma, Monosodium Phosphate is used in detergents, ceramics, and textile processing. Its dispersing and buffering properties improve industrial processes and product performance.

What is Monosodium Phosphate (MSP)?

Monosodium Phosphate (MSP) is a sodium salt of phosphoric acid with the formula NaH₂PO₄ and CAS 7558-80-7, acting as a pH buffer and sequestrant. It’s a white, water-soluble powder used to regulate acidity and stabilize formulations in food and industrial products.

How is MSP used in food processing?

Incorporate MSP at 0.2-0.5% during mixing to adjust pH and emulsify fats; for baking, add to dry ingredients for controlled acidification. Conduct stability tests to optimize dosage for specific recipes.

Is MSP safe for consumption?

Yes, MSP is FDA GRAS and approved by JECFA up to 70 mg/kg phosphorus equivalent in foods, with rapid absorption and no established toxicity at typical usage levels.

What is the shelf life of MSP?

Stored in airtight containers in a cool, dry environment, MSP maintains full activity for 2-3 years, though hygroscopic—monitor for clumping in humid conditions.

Can MSP be blended with other phosphates?

MSP synergizes with disodium phosphate for pH gradients in buffers but may precipitate with excess calcium; it’s compatible in most blends after pilot testing.

Does MSP alter the flavor of products?

MSP’s mild acidity imparts no off-flavors at standard doses, preserving natural tastes in beverages and dairy while enhancing freshness through preservation.
